Output 6ffada20dedc5c0c60227e8cab2bf9759043baf8c122ce27e8064216f7e50640:1

value
377341
script pubkey
OP_0 OP_PUSHBYTES_20 c3873ab4539d9c0f5fa40e238e2f949e2373bed4
address
bc1qcwrn4dznnkwq7haypc3cutu5nc3h80k53pc7hj
transaction
6ffada20dedc5c0c60227e8cab2bf9759043baf8c122ce27e8064216f7e50640
confirmations
165649
spent
true